+
+/// Convert a byte idx into a string into a char idx for consumption by annotate_snippets.
+fn char_idx_from_byte_idx(input: &str, idx: usize) -> usize {
+ let char_idx = input
+ .char_indices()
+ .enumerate()
+ .find(|(_, (i, _))| *i == idx)
+ .unwrap()
+ .0;
+ // Unix-style newlines are counted as two chars (see
+ // https://github.com/rust-lang/annotate-snippets-rs/issues/24).
+ let nbr_newlines = input[..idx].chars().filter(|c| *c == '\n').count();
+ let nbr_carriage_returns =
+ input[..idx].chars().filter(|c| *c == '\r').count();
+ char_idx + nbr_newlines - nbr_carriage_returns
+}
